Addition of a solute to pure water causes

Options

(a) Negative water potential
(b) More negative water potential
(c) Positive water potential
(d) More positive water potential

Correct Answer:

Negative water potential

Explanation:

The pure water, at atmospheric pressure, has zero water potential.The addition of any solute particles reduces the free energy of water . Thus the water potential will be negative .
